Merchandise Planner, Sr. jobs in Gulfport, MS

Merchandise Planner, Sr. plans and forecasts for future merchandise buys based on historical buys, reoccurring buys and current inventory levels. Responsible for reviewing stock to sales ratios, responding to changing sales trends, and ensuring plan sales, plan markups, and plan markdowns are achieved by departments. Being a Merchandise Planner, Sr. may require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. To be a Merchandise Planner, Sr. typically requires 4 to 7 years of related experience.     Position Overview

    The Planner III performs varied and complex professional urban planning and responsible administrative work in conducting major activities, special programs or programs of the Planning Division of the Department of Urban Development. Work is performed under the general supervision of the Planning Division Administrator and independent judgment is exercised in the formulation of reports, plans, studies and recommendations on a variety of urban planning issues and methodologies employed. Supervision is exercised over all subordinate professional, technical and clerical personnel in the preparation and revision of Master Comprehensive Plan elements, special projects and related planning work.

    Essential Job Functions

    Essential duties and functions, pursuant to the Americans with Disabilities Act, May include the following. Other related duties may be assigned.

    • Develops and prepares major reports, policies and projects for assigned area of those involving other departments, commissions or boards and private developers.

    • Directs the city's comprehensive planning program in the preparation and updating of plans necessary for the formulation of elements of the Master Comprehensive Plan, the implementation tools of those plans and other basic and applied planning studies concerning the physical development of urban areas.

    • Assists in directing the development and application of new methods of research design and analysis.

    • Responds to public inquiries, both orally and in writing, regarding applications and interpretations of the City’s Comprehensive Plan, Land Use and Development Regulations and Ordinances.

    • Provide guidance to Planner I and II.

    • Oversees population, socio-economic, housing, land use and transportation data collection and analysis and prepares estimates and projections.

    • Conducts field inspections.

Gulfport is the second-largest city in Mississippi after the state capital, Jackson. Along with Biloxi, Gulfport is the other county seat of Harrison County and the larger of the two principal cities of the Gulfport-Biloxi, Mississippi Metropolitan Statistical Area, which is included in the Gulfport-Biloxi-Pascagoula, Mississippi Combined Statistical Area. As of the 2010 census, the city of Gulfport had a total population of 67,793. It is also home to the US Navy Atlantic Fleet Seabees.
